The University of Oregon is covering the controversial murals that have decorated the halls of its largest library after years of protest over the murals' racist language and portrayal of indigenous people
The university made the announcement Wednesday, saying the move was in part an acknowledgment of the larger conversations occurring about racism in the US."In a move to acknowledge conversations about anti-racism taking place around the world amid the Black Lives Matter movement, the University of Oregon has ordered four murals in the Knight Library that contain racist, exclusionary language and imagery to be covered," a statement from the school reads.
And though the murals are now set to be covered, the push to have them removed has been a long one. The"Mission of a University" mural has been vandalized multiple times, as recently as June 2020."I am firmly against the destruction or censoring of art in any form, but it would be disingenuous for anyone to say that these pieces, especially in a library whose central mission is to welcome and support the entire campus, are 'just art,'" Phillips said.
